Vishay SQS201CENW Series Single MOSFETs, 100V Maximum Drain Source Voltage, 16A Maximum Continuous Drain Current - SQS201CENW-T1_GE3
This single MOSFETs device is a P‑channel enhancement MOSFET designed for power switching in demanding electronic systems. It operates over a broad ambient range and is suitable for PCB mounting in environments requiring high drain voltage capability and significant continuous current handling.
Features and Benefits:
• 100V drain withstand for high-voltage switching capability
• 16A continuous current for heavy-load conduction
• 62.5W power dissipation enables sustained power handling
• 0.0800Ω low Rds(on) reduces conduction losses
• 26nC typical gate charge for efficient switching control
• ±20V gate tolerance supports robust drive signalling

What thermal extremes can the device tolerate during operation?
It is rated to operate from -55°C up to 175°C, allowing use in wide-temperature environments.
What package style and mounting method does it use for PCB assembly?
It is supplied in a PowerPAK 8‑pin package designed for direct PCB mounting to improve thermal performance.
How does the device support automotive applications?
It meets AEC‑Q101 requirements, making it suitable for vehicle electronic systems that need automotive‑grade components.
What gate drive considerations should be observed for reliable switching?
The gate can accept up to 20V relative to source and the typical gate charge is 26nC, which informs driver sizing and switching-loss calculations.
